The City of Salem's Urban Renewal Agency convened on August 25, 2025, to discuss key financial updates and future planning for urban development. With Mayor Julie Hoy absent, Councillor Gwynne stepped in as presiding officer, guiding the meeting through a streamlined agenda that included the approval of the consent calendar and a financial overview.
The meeting began with a roll call, confirming the presence of all board members except for the chair. Following the approval of the consent calendar, which included minutes from the previous meeting, the focus shifted to information reports. Acting Director Rutherford addressed inquiries regarding urban renewal finances, particularly the North Gateway Urban Renewal Area, which has accrued significant tax increment resources over the years.
Rutherford highlighted that the North Gateway area is nearing its maximum indebtedness, expected to be reached within a year. This means the agency will stop collecting tax increment funds, emphasizing the urgency of utilizing the available resources effectively. She noted that some funds are earmarked for transportation projects and grant programs, while others will support the redevelopment of a contaminated property within the area.
The agency plans to present a detailed report and presentation on urban renewal at the next meeting in September, aiming to clarify how the approximately $30 million in available resources will be allocated. This upcoming session is anticipated to provide the community with insights into the strategic use of funds and ongoing urban development initiatives.
